She Mine is a 3 year old bay filly. She Mine is trained by G R Ryan, at Deagon and owned by Mrs L A Ryan.
She Mine’s last race event was at 20/04/2024 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.
Career form is 3 wins, 1 seconds, thirds from 14 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$71,923.
With a 21% Win Percentage and 29% Place Percentage. She Mine's last race event was at Eagle Farm.
Exposed form for its last starts is 9-0-8-9-1.
